Roush if you've got a low chin spoiler like the CDC Aggressive. BMR for everything else, it drops the front 1.25" and the rear 1.75".

BMR 05+ Mustang Lowering Package

Package includes:
[*]Lowering Springs(SP009) [*]Upper Strut Mount(SM001) [*]Camber Bolts(FC001) [*]Adjustable Panhard Rod(PHR006) [*]Control Arm Relocation Brackets(CAB005)
